- The distance between Stavanger, Rogaland, Norway and Mutsu, Japan is approximately 8,150 km or 5,064 mi.
- To reach Stavanger, Rogaland in this distance one would set out from Mutsu bearing 337.8°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Stavanger, Rogaland bearing 213.3° or SSW .
- Both have a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Both are in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 1.8 °C (3.2°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 9.9 °C (17.8°F) less in Stavanger, Rogaland.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 117.1 mm (4.6 in) less which is equivalent to 117.1 l/m² (2.87 US gal/ft²) or 1,171,000 l/ha (125,188 US gal/ac) less. About 1 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 17.5° lower in Stavanger, Rogaland than in Mutsu.
- Relative humidity levels are 2.6%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 1.4°C (2.5°F) lower.
